Radish Schedule — All Zones
| Zone | Start Indoors | Transplant | Direct Sow | Harvest Start | Harvest End |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Zone 2 | — | — | May 25 | Jun 21 | Aug 3 |
| Zone 3 | — | — | May 15 | Jun 11 | Jul 24 |
| Zone 4 | — | — | May 10 | Jun 6 | Jul 19 |
| Zone 5 | — | — | Apr 30 | May 27 | Jul 9 |
| Zone 6 | — | — | Apr 15 | May 12 | Jun 24 |
| Zone 7 | — | — | Apr 5 | May 2 | Jun 14 |
| Zone 8 | — | — | Mar 20 | Apr 16 | May 29 |
| Zone 9 | — | — | Feb 28 | Mar 27 | May 9 |
| Zone 10 | — | — | Feb 10 | Mar 9 | Apr 21 |
| Zone 11 | — | — | Jan 15 | Feb 11 | Mar 26 |
